weight 3 · round to CrossmintCrossmint's Agent Cards give agents a one-time card number, expiration, and CVC scoped by an order intent with amount, description, merchant lock, and expiration — never exposing the real card number — enforced via Visa/Mastercard network rails (crossmint-supp-2, crossmint-supp-3, crossmint-supp-8). This is corroborated by a live runtime probe showing the agent-scoped checkout endpoint requiring agent-specific credentials (crossmint-probe-rt-1). Missing for 10: independent third-party (non-vendor) verification of the card-scoping behavior in production beyond the docs and single runtime probe.

Skyfire issues scoped pay/kya-pay tokens with committed amount ceilings, expiry windows (10s-24h plus grace period), and merchant/identity-requirement gating rather than raw card numbers, all documented via API and MCP server tooling. Missing for 10: independent third-party/hands-on corroboration beyond vendor docs, and explicit merchant-restriction scoping details (evidence shows identity/amount/time limits clearly but merchant-lock-in specifics are thinner).

Skyfire's docs explicitly allocate payment risk: sellers are guaranteed payment up to a token's committed amount and 'do not carry buyer non-payment risk' (skyfire-supp-4), overcharges are rejected, and even after account deactivation in-flight tokens are still honored so sellers get paid (skyfire-supp-6). Card-based flows also state the agent can never exceed cardholder-approved amounts and purchases are never anonymous to the merchant (skyfire-supp-7). However, there is no dedicated chargeback/dispute-resolution policy, no explicit statement of who bears fraud losses when credentials are stolen or a buyer disputes via their bank, and no formal merchant-facing liability/ToS document. Missing for 10: explicit chargeback/dispute process, stolen-credential fraud liability terms, formal merchant liability agreement or ToS reference.
